How We Remove Water in 4 Steps

Proper water removal needs a step-by-step process to ensure that all water is extracted, and your home is safe and dry. Here's what you can expect from our team:

Step 1: Assessment and Containment

Our technicians will arrive and begin assessing the damage, identifying the source of the water, and creating a plan for removal. We'll also contain the affected area to prevent further damage and create a safe work environment.

Step 2: Water Extraction

Using our state-of-the-art equipment, we'll extract as much water as possible from the affected area, including up to 2 inches of standing water. This process typically takes 30-60 minutes, depending on the size of the affected area.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

Next, we'll set up specialized drying equipment to remove any remaining moisture from the affected area. This may include dehumidifiers, air movers, and other equipment designed to reduce drying time and prevent further damage.

Step 4: Final Inspection and Repair

Once the affected area is dry, our technicians will conduct a final inspection to ensure that all water has been removed and that your home is safe and secure. We'll also identify any necessary repairs and provide a detailed estimate for completion.

Emergency Water Removal (24/7) Cost in DC Ranch, AZ

The cost of emergency water removal can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in DC Ranch, AZ. Here's a breakdown of what you can expect to pay: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Initial Assessment and Containment $100 - $500 Size of affected area, complexity of damage
Water Extraction and Removal $500 - $2,500 Size of affected area, amount of water extracted
Drying and Dehumidification $200 - $1,000 Size of affected area, complexity of damage
Final Inspection and Repair $100 - $500 Size of affected area, complexity of damage
